The Pedalflow rebalancing scheduler began returning 401 errors at 03:12 after its credential for the internal dockstate service expired. As a result, overnight van routes were not generated, and several stations in the Carverton district are reporting full or empty docks. A replacement key has been issued and validated against staging; the scheduler only needs the config value updated and a restart of the pedalflow-planner pod. Expiry monitoring for this credential will be added as a follow-up. The new key follows.

app token of hahag-kafog = qvz7-KHpOyEw

**Ticket: Nightly catalogue import failing — expired credentials**

The Fernvale library catalogue import has failed three consecutive nights. Logs show the Shelfline ingest service rejecting our token as expired; it was issued during the Q2 migration and never rotated. A replacement credential has been provisioned with identical scopes, valid for twelve months. Please update the release pipeline secret store with the new key shown below.

gateway credential: vxb11-v9yOsaxubAz

Subject: Partner SFTP drop — new owner

Hi,

As you review the pending changes to the Harborline ingest scripts, note that ownership of the partner SFTP drop is changing at the end of the month. This includes key rotation, the nightly pull job, and the quarantine folder for malformed files. Review comments on the retry logic should still go through the normal PR flow, but questions about drop-folder conventions or partner onboarding now go to the new owner. The incoming owner is listed below.

signatory, tagaf-bahaf: Praael Fenmir Rusok

Marta,

Cut-over finished at 03:40 with zero downtime. Expand-contract worked as planned: dual-writes ran for six hours, backfill verified against the shadow table, old columns dropped after the read-traffic flip. No rollbacks triggered. Quillbrook replicas lagged briefly (~40s) but recovered before the contract phase. Drift checks are green. One follow-up: the migration runner's settings were tuned for the cut-over and should stay pinned until v13 planning. Current runner configuration follows.

config for kawif-hahig:
zorix:
  log_level: error
  metrics_host: metrics.zorix.lumiclabs.internal
  pool_size: 16